- 8005 N 146th East Avenue, Owasso, OK 74055
- 8207 N 128th East Avenue, Owasso, OK 74055
- 7806 N 121st East Avenue, Owasso, OK 74055
- 8210 N 126th Avenue, Owasso, OK 74055
- 7716 N 150th East Court, Owasso, OK 74055
- 11829 E 80th Place, Owasso, OK 74055
- 8307 N 126th East Avenue, Owasso, OK 74055
- 8007 N 146th East Avenue, Owasso, OK 74055
- 7402 E 89th Street N, Owasso, OK 74055
- 8214 N 122nd East Avenue, Owasso, OK 74055
Displaying 10 out of 10